On Tue, 23 Nov 2021, Jens Axboe wrote:
> It looks like some missed accounting. You can just disable wbt for now, would
> be a useful data point to see if that fixes it. Just do:
> echo 0 > /sys/block/nvme0n1/queue/wbt_lat_usec
> and that will disable writeback throttling on that device.
It's been about 48 hours and haven't seen the issue since doing this.
